Advanced space frame designs have opened the door to more efficient and effective water collection methods. One such approach involves employing space frames as versatile water conduits. This design leverages the structural benefits to redirect rainwater intake and direct it downward through a network of channels and collection points.
Another novel method incorporates solar-powered condensation systems. In areas where humidity levels are high, a thin membrane is integrated into the space frame's structure. As air comes into proximity to the thin membrane, moisture accumulates on its surface. When accumulated moisture reaches a threshold, the collected water is systematically drained and transported to a reservoir.
A third method capitalizes advanced materials and surface technologies to fabricate wetting-resistant coatings for space frame surfaces. These coatings are capable of redirecting rainwater droplets, allowing them to roll off harmlessly.
